In Nigeria, Atiku Abubakar, former Vice-President and historic figure of the opposition, announced Wednesday, July 16, that he was leaving the PDP with which he had been a candidate in the last two presidential elections. In recent months, Nigeria's main opposition party has seen defections in its ranks.
2027: Atiku left PDP because it has no voice - Phrank Shuaibu
Special Adviser to former Vice President Atiku Abubakar on Communications and Strategy, Phrank Shuaibu, has revealed why his principal resigned from the Peoples Democratic Party. Speaking as a guest on Sunrise Daily, a programme on Channels Television on Thursday, Shuaibu said Atiku left the PDP because the party has lost its voice, favour, and vitality to serve as the right opposition to the current administration.
